Productivity of Spirulina under using of various type of light sources | Продуктивность спирулины при использовании источников света различного типа

In the conditions of the Republic of Belarus there was studied the possibility of substitutuion of traditional light sources by lamps of new generation and there was studied the influence of sources of various spectral structure on Spirulina. In course of the study there was applied strain Spirulina (Arthrospira) platensis Geitl PPMSU-59 from the collection of Lomonosov Moscow State University (Russian Federation). Using for Spirulina cultivation of lamps TL-D36/54-765 and L36W/77 FLUORA leads to economy of the electric power, growth of productivity and allows receiving the increased contents of proteins and pigments (especially phycocyanin) in algae biomass in comparison with the biomass of cyanobacteria cultivated at illumination by lamps SL40W/32-765. It was also shownin case of illumination of Spirulina by lamps with light of different spectral composition (white, yellow, red and blue), the yellow light causes increase in the content of protein, carotinoids, phycocyanin and chlorophyll in the biomass by 17, 8, 20 and 8 % respectively. At the same time, red light caused the lowering of protein, chlorophyll and carotinoids content.
